Belajar Seo – JavaScript adalah bahasa pemrograman yang kuat dan fleksibel yang banyak digunakan untuk mengembangkan situs web modern dan aplikasi web. Namun, ketika datang ke SEO (Search Engine Optimization), JavaScript dapat menimbulkan tantangan tersendiri. Mesin pencari seperti Google semakin canggih dalam merender dan memahami konten berbasis JavaScript, tetapi tetap ada beberapa aspek yang perlu diperhatikan agar situs web Anda dapat diindeks dengan baik dan mendapat peringkat tinggi di hasil pencarian. Dalam panduan ini, kita akan menjelajahi cara memahami dan mengoptimalkan JavaScript untuk SEO dengan lebih mendalam.
Strategi Efektif untuk Mengoptimalkan SEO Situs Web Berbasis JavaScript
1. Memahami Bagaimana Mesin Pencari Merender JavaScript
Sebelum memulai pengoptimalan, penting untuk memahami bagaimana mesin pencari merender JavaScript. Mesin pencari seperti Googlebot awalnya mengindeks situs web dengan cara yang mirip dengan pengguna biasa, yaitu melalui HTML statis. Namun, ketika situs menggunakan JavaScript untuk memuat atau menghasilkan konten dinamis, Googlebot harus merender dan mengeksekusi JavaScript tersebut untuk mengakses konten yang relevan.
Googlebot menggunakan dua tahap untuk merender JavaScript:
- Tahap 1: Pengambilan dan Render HTML – Googlebot pertama-tama mengakses HTML awal dan melihat konten statis.
- Tahap 2: Eksekusi JavaScript – Googlebot kemudian memproses dan menjalankan JavaScript untuk memuat konten dinamis dan interaktif.
Penting untuk memastikan bahwa konten penting tidak hanya tersedia melalui JavaScript, tetapi juga dapat diakses melalui HTML awal jika memungkinkan.
2. Menilai Kelayakan SEO Situs Berbasis JavaScript
Sebelum melanjutkan dengan pengoptimalan, lakukan penilaian awal untuk menentukan seberapa baik situs Anda dioptimalkan untuk SEO. Ada beberapa alat yang dapat membantu Anda dalam menilai kelayakan SEO situs berbasis JavaScript:
- Google Search Console: Alat ini memberikan wawasan tentang bagaimana Googlebot melihat dan merender situs Anda. Anda dapat menggunakan fitur “Render sebagai Google” untuk melihat bagaimana Googlebot mengakses halaman Anda.
- Lighthouse: Alat audit situs web yang terintegrasi dengan Chrome DevTools ini dapat memberikan laporan tentang kinerja SEO dan memberi tahu Anda tentang masalah yang mungkin timbul dari penggunaan JavaScript.
- Mobile-Friendly Test: Karena banyak pengguna mengakses situs web melalui perangkat seluler, penting untuk memeriksa apakah situs Anda ramah seluler dan dapat diakses dengan baik melalui ponsel. Lihat rekomendasi lainnya → Pusat4d Gaming
3. Mengoptimalkan JavaScript untuk SEO
Ada beberapa strategi yang dapat membantu Anda mengoptimalkan JavaScript untuk SEO:
- Prerendering dan Server-Side Rendering (SSR): Salah satu cara terbaik untuk memastikan bahwa mesin pencari dapat mengakses konten JavaScript Anda adalah dengan menggunakan prerendering atau SSR. Prerendering memungkinkan Anda untuk menghasilkan versi HTML statis dari halaman yang dimuat JavaScript sebelum diakses oleh pengguna atau mesin pencari. SSR, di sisi lain, menghasilkan konten HTML di server sebelum mengirimkannya ke pengguna.Framework seperti Next.js dan Nuxt.js mendukung SSR dan dapat membantu Anda memastikan bahwa konten penting dihasilkan di server sebelum dikirim ke klien.
- Mengoptimalkan Penggunaan JavaScript: Kurangi ketergantungan pada JavaScript untuk konten penting. Pastikan bahwa elemen kunci seperti judul, deskripsi meta, dan struktur HTML utama tersedia dalam HTML awal. Ini memastikan bahwa mesin pencari dapat mengakses informasi penting meskipun JavaScript tidak dijalankan dengan benar.
- Menggunakan Teknik Lazy Loading dengan Bijak: Lazy loading adalah teknik untuk menunda pemuatan gambar atau elemen lain hingga mereka diperlukan. Meskipun ini dapat meningkatkan kinerja situs, pastikan bahwa elemen penting tidak terlalu terlambat dimuat sehingga tidak mempengaruhi indeksasi oleh mesin pencari.
- Memastikan Keterbacaan dan Kecepatan: JavaScript yang mempengaruhi kinerja situs dapat memengaruhi SEO. Pastikan bahwa skrip Anda tidak menyebabkan waktu muat halaman yang lambat. Gunakan alat seperti Google PageSpeed Insights untuk menganalisis kecepatan halaman dan mengidentifikasi area untuk perbaikan.
Baca Juga : Cara Mengoptimalkan Pengalaman Pengguna Melalui Strategi SEO yang Efektif
4. Menyediakan Alternatif untuk Konten Dinamis
Konten dinamis yang dihasilkan oleh JavaScript bisa menjadi tantangan untuk diindeks. Salah satu solusinya adalah dengan menyediakan alternatif konten statis jika memungkinkan. Misalnya, jika Anda memiliki konten yang dihasilkan oleh JavaScript, pertimbangkan untuk menyediakannya dalam format HTML statis atau memberikan fallback konten yang relevan.
5. Menggunakan Metadata dan Schema Markup
Untuk membantu mesin pencari memahami konten JavaScript Anda, pertimbangkan untuk menambahkan metadata dan schema markup. Schema markup adalah jenis data terstruktur yang dapat membantu mesin pencari memahami konteks dan makna konten Anda. Misalnya, menggunakan schema markup untuk menandai informasi produk, acara, atau artikel dapat membantu mesin pencari menampilkan informasi yang relevan dalam hasil pencarian.
6. Memantau dan Menganalisis Kinerja SEO
Setelah Anda menerapkan strategi pengoptimalan, penting untuk memantau dan menganalisis kinerja SEO situs Anda secara terus-menerus. Gunakan alat analisis web untuk melacak peringkat pencarian, lalu lintas organik, dan kinerja halaman. Ini dapat membantu Anda mengidentifikasi masalah potensial dan membuat penyesuaian jika diperlukan. Lihat rekomendasi lainnya → Kilau4d Gaming
7. Mengatasi Masalah Umum dengan JavaScript SEO
Ada beberapa masalah umum yang dapat mempengaruhi SEO situs berbasis JavaScript:
- Penghalang JavaScript: Beberapa situs mungkin mengalami masalah di mana JavaScript menghalangi konten penting dari tampil. Pastikan bahwa JavaScript tidak menghalangi akses ke elemen utama halaman.
- Keterlambatan Render: Konten yang memerlukan waktu lama untuk dirender dapat mempengaruhi pengalaman pengguna dan SEO. Optimalkan skrip Anda untuk mengurangi waktu render.
- Bot Crawling: Mesin pencari mungkin menghadapi kesulitan dalam merender JavaScript jika ada masalah dengan pengaturan crawling atau JavaScript itu sendiri. Pastikan bahwa pengaturan robots.txt dan meta tag tidak memblokir akses mesin pencari ke konten penting.
Mengoptimalkan JavaScript untuk SEO memerlukan pemahaman yang mendalam tentang bagaimana mesin pencari merender dan mengakses konten JavaScript. Dengan menggunakan strategi seperti prerendering, server-side rendering, dan pengoptimalan skrip, Anda dapat memastikan bahwa situs web Anda dapat diindeks dengan baik dan mendapat peringkat tinggi di hasil pencarian. Selalu pantau dan analisis kinerja SEO situs Anda untuk memastikan bahwa strategi yang diterapkan tetap efektif dan sesuai dengan perkembangan terbaru dalam praktik SEO. Dengan pendekatan yang tepat, Anda dapat memaksimalkan visibilitas dan keberhasilan situs web berbasis JavaScript Anda.